Библиотека

Разработчикам

Статьи коллег, собственные и переводные, ссылки на комментарии экспертов CMS Magazine.

Ловля штрих-кода на живца

Ловля штрих-кода

Безмерно мудрый русский народ говорит, что  «для рыбалки мало страсти — нужны еще и снасти». Перефразировав пословицу, можно сказать, что для считывания штрих-кода не достаточно одного лишь сканера, нужна еще специализированная программа, способная принять, обработать и передать считанный штрих-код по назначению. Андрей Литвинов ловит рыбу в мутной воде способов считывания данных со сканеров.

Художественная дистанция

«Художественная дистанция». Иллюстрация Арины Терентьевой

Пол Бартон, основатель 16toads Design, рассказывает, как правильно критиковать дизайн сайтов (и не только сайтов) и вызывает из небытия старый термин «художественная дистанция». Несколько простых приёмов, позволяющих научиться правильно оценивать свой дизайн и работы коллег, в очередном переводе Дмитрия Склярова с разрешения журнала A List Apart.

Фильтрация справочников в DIRECTUM

А вот креветка-фильтратор не нуждается в специальных функциях...

Дмитрий Третьяков демонстрирует универсальную функцию фильтрации справочников в DIRECTUM. Известно, что что стандартные функции DIRECTUM фильтруют всё, что нужно, за исключением той ситуации, когда пользователю необходимо дать возможность изменить значения реквизитов фильтрации, заданных по умолчанию. Знакомо? Читайте и скачивайте пример!

Искусственное ожирение

Использование Google Fonts

Перевод статьи Алана Стирнса из Adobe Web Platform Team о том, как правильно использовать на сайтах внешние шрифты на примере Google Fonts. На страницах журнала A List Apart 8 мая 2012 года Алан рассказал, как браузеры издеваются над шрифтами, и что нужно сделать разработчику, чтобы шрифтам было хорошо.

Девять причин сказать «нет» клиенту

Девять причин сказать «Нет»

Правильному выбору исполнителя посвящено много материалов, а о выборе заказчика говорят мало, ибо «клиент всегда прав». Статья Дмитрия Склярова, напечатанная в январе 2012 журналом CMS Magazine, рассказывает о том, как правильно выбирать клиентов. Эти несложные правила помогают нам в работе вот уже 10 лет.

Мастер? Действуй!

Мастер действий

Андрей Литвинов делится опытом использования мастера действий при формировании отчётов в СЭД DIRECTUM. Дело несложное, если применить компоненту с характерным названием «Разработка отчетов»: можно обойтись без применения функций InputDialog и InputDialogEx.